What is the CSET Math Subtest 1?
The CSET Math Subtest 1 primarily focuses on foundational mathematical knowledge including algebra, number theory, and functions. It serves as a gateway to demonstrating proficiency in essential math topics required for teaching at elementary and middle school levels. The exam is divided into multiple-choice questions and constructed response questions, with the latter requiring detailed written answers.
Understanding Constructed Response Questions
Constructed response questions are open-ended items where test-takers write out their solutions and reasoning processes. Unlike multiple-choice questions, these responses help examiners evaluate critical thinking, problem-solving abilities, and depth of understanding. They often involve solving problems, explaining mathematical concepts, or justifying methods used to reach an answer.
Key Strategies for Success
1. Read Carefully: Carefully analyze the question prompt to understand what is being asked. Pay attention to details and any constraints provided.
2. Organize Your Response: Structure your answer logically by outlining steps clearly. Use proper mathematical notation and language.
3. Show Your Work: Demonstrate all intermediate steps and calculations. This gives insight into your thought process and can earn partial credit even if the final answer is incorrect.
4. Review Mathematical Concepts: Brush up on key topics such as algebraic expressions, linear equations, inequalities, and functions, which are frequently tested.
Common Topics in Constructed Responses
Typical constructed response questions will cover a range of topics including:
- Solving linear equations and inequalities
- Writing and interpreting functions
- Factoring polynomials
- Understanding number properties and operations
- Applying problem-solving techniques
